How do I choose the best crypto wallet for my needs?

1. Security Needs 

  • If security is your top priority → Cold Wallet (Hardware or Paper)
    • Examples: Ledger Nano X, Trezor Model T
    • Best for long-term holding (HODLing) and large investments.
  • If convenience is more important → Hot Wallet (Software or Mobile)
    • Examples: MetaMask, Trust Wallet, Coinbase Wallet
    • Ideal for everyday transactions and DeFi but slightly less secure.

2. Custodial vs. Non-Custodial 

  • If you don’t want to manage private keys → Custodial Wallet
    • Example: Keeping crypto on Coinbase, Binance, or Kraken.
    • Good for beginners who prefer an easy-to-use option.
  • If you want full control over your funds → Non-Custodial Wallet
    • Example: MetaMask, Trust Wallet, Ledger.
    • Best for those who value privacy and control.

3. Type of Cryptocurrencies Supported 

  • Not all wallets support all coins! Check compatibility.
    • For Bitcoin: Electrum, Ledger
    • For Ethereum & DeFi: MetaMask, Trust Wallet
    • For multi-crypto: Exodus, Atomic Wallet

4. Features & Use Case 

  • Trading & Easy Access → Exchange wallets (Binance, Coinbase)
  • DeFi & NFTs → MetaMask, Trust Wallet
  • Long-Term Storage → Ledger, Trezor
  • Mobile Convenience → Trust Wallet, Coinbase Wallet

5. User-Friendliness 

  • Beginner-Friendly: Coinbase Wallet, Trust Wallet
  • Advanced Features: Ledger, Trezor (Hardware), MetaMask (DeFi)

Final Recommendation 

  • Best for Beginners: Trust Wallet, Coinbase Wallet
  • Best for Security: Ledger Nano X, Trezor
  • Best for DeFi & NFTs: MetaMask
  • Best for Multi-Crypto: Exodus, Atomic Wallet
